Argentine football legend Lionel Messi has officially signed a new contract with Inter Miami, extending his stay at the Major League Soccer (MLS) club until December 2028.
The deal, confirmed on Thursday, follows reports last week of a verbal agreement between Messi and the club’s management.
The MLS has now approved all the formal steps required for the contract extension.
With the new deal, Messi is set to remain at Inter Miami for three more years, continuing his role as the face of the club and one of the biggest stars in American football.
Messi, who joined Inter Miami in 2023 after leaving Paris Saint-Germain, has been instrumental in raising the profile of the MLS both on and off the pitch. His presence has attracted record attendances, boosted global viewership, and drawn several high-profile players to the league.
Inter Miami are expected to build their long-term sporting project around the eight-time Ballon d’Or winner, as they aim for sustained success in domestic and continental competitions.
